WebBIOSYNTHESIS OF GLYCOSIDES. The glycosides are the condensation products of sugar and the acceptor unit called as aglycone. The reaction occurs in two parts as given below. Firstly sugar phosphates bind with uridine triphosphate (UTP) to produce sugar—uridine diphosphate sugar complex. This sugar nucleotide complex reacts with acceptor units ...
